At the heart of every online slot is a Random Number Generator (RNG), a mathematical algorithm that continuously produces thousands of number sequences per second, even when the game is idle. When you press spin, the RNG instantly captures the current number, which maps directly to the symbols on the reels. This process ensures each spin is entirely independent of the previous one. The RNG does not “remember” past outcomes, so patterns or hot streaks are illusions of chance.
An RNG’s core mechanism is simply a non-stop, seed-based number stream that halts at the moment of spin, guaranteeing that every result is purely random and unpredictable.
Understanding paylines, reels, and symbols in digital format is foundational to gameplay. Digital reels are virtual columns that spin via a random number generator, aligning symbols across predetermined paylines. Unlike classic one-line machines, modern slots feature adjustable paylines—ranging from 10 to over 1,000—which define winning patterns, often running left to right. Symbols, including wilds and scatters, trigger multipliers or bonus rounds when landing in specific combinations on active paylines. Each symbol’s payout value and frequency are embedded in the game’s paytable, making pre-spin analysis critical for evaluating potential returns.
Paylines determine win paths, reels provide the digital spin mechanism, and symbols define reward triggers; mastering their interaction is key to strategic slot play.
RTP (Return to Player) represents the theoretical percentage of all wagered money a slot online pays back over time, so a 96% RTP means you’ll get back $96 for every $100 bet in the long run. Volatility, or variance, describes the risk level: low volatility offers frequent but smaller wins, while high volatility delivers larger but less frequent payouts. These two metrics directly influence your bankroll strategy. A high-volatility game with high RTP can drain funds quickly, but offers potential for big payouts, whereas low-volatility slots are better for extending play. Understanding volatility and RTP together helps you choose a slot online that matches your risk tolerance and session goals.
RTP tells you the theoretical return over time; volatility tells you the risk and payout frequency. Pick slots where both align with your bankroll and playing style.

Modern slot online games feature free spins rounds with multipliers that significantly boost payouts. Bonus rounds trigger when specific scatter symbols appear, often awarding a set number of spins with a 2x, 3x, or higher multiplier applied to all wins. Some slots let you retrigger additional free spins within the bonus round, extending gameplay. Multipliers can also apply to wild symbols during these phases, multiplying combination values. Progressive multipliers may increase with each consecutive win, offering escalating rewards. Picking the right bonus round often depends on your volatility preference, as higher multipliers typically carry greater risk.
Understanding the difference between progressive slots and fixed pools shapes your online gaming strategy. Fixed prize pools offer predetermined, static payouts for specific symbol combinations, providing predictable returns. Progressive jackpots, however, accumulate a portion of every bet across a network, growing until one lucky spin triggers the full amount. While progressives can create life-changing wins, they often feature lower base game RTPs to fund the growing prize. Q: Which offers better winning odds? A: Fixed pools typically provide more frequent, smaller wins due to stable odds, whereas progressive jackpots rely on extreme volatility for that single, massive payout chance.

Fairness in online slots is determined by a Random Number Generator (RNG), a software algorithm that ensures every spin’s outcome is independent and unpredictable. To verify this, check if the game provider publishes an RNG audit from a known testing laboratory. Additionally, review the game’s Return to Player (RTP) percentage, which indicates long-term theoretical payback. Observe your own short-term results—while streaks happen, consistency over hundreds of spins can hint at fairness.
